Therapeutic use of anti-CS1 antibodies
View Patent ↗The present invention is directed to antagonists of CS1 that bind to and neutralize at least one biological activity of CS1. The invention also includes a pharmaceutical composition comprising such antibodies or antigen-binding fragments thereof. The present invention also provides for a method of preventing or treating disease states, including autoimmune disorders and cancer, in a subject in need thereof, comprising administering into said subject an effective amount of such antagonists.
1. A method of treating multiple myeloma, comprising the step of administering to a patient in need thereof a therapeutically effective amount of a combination of:
(a) a monoclonal anti-CS1 antibody or an anti-CS1 antigen binding fragment, wherein said monoclonal anti-CS1 antibody or anti-CS1 antigen binding fragment binds to a protein encoded by SEQ ID NO:1 and comprises
(i) a heavy chain variable region with complementarity determining region (CDR) sequences having amino acid sequences of SEQ ID NO:15, SEQ ID NO:16 or SEQ ID NO:87, and SEQ ID NO:17; and
(ii) a light chain variable region with CDR sequences having amino acid sequences of SEQ ID NO:18, SEQ ID NO:19, and SEQ ID NO:20; and
(b) velcade.
